About the centre and role

The Marion Centre is a specialist resource base, which supports students with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D). The centre was set up in 2009 and moved to a £5m purpose built building in 2013. We have an excellent team of teaching and support staff who provide all students with a very high quality of education. At present there are approximately 65 students within the centre. Nearly all students are taught exclusively by centre staff. Upon transfer to secondary school, many students are functioning at P scale levels within National curriculum. Therefore, these students receive a specialist curriculum in place to support their individual needs and pathway. The successful post holder will be responsible for an individual class and address the needs of students who need particular help to overcome barriers to learning.

The post would suit an individual with experience of working with students with additional learning needs in either a primary or secondary setting.
